Its a great product, but like any overflow system built in or not, you have to make sure it doesn't clog, and that you supplement the pump with an overflow switch. The switch is critical to prevent any flooding of your house. It has a little floater that will cut off the pump if the level gets too high in the main tank. Also make sure you keep your sump only partially full, as you need to make sure it wont fill the sump to overflow if the power/pump goes out.

This overflow box does what it's designed to do, but the addition of the aqua-lifter pump to maintain the siphon is critical. However, the nipple connection for the air removal pump is over on the left. Not all the air ends up on the left!! You must set the left foot screw higher than the right one so that you get a right to left upwards slope. This will make the air bubbles collect on the left for easy removal with the aqua-lifter. For weeks, I couldn't figure out why the flow rate over the overflow was so low and it was because there was a large air pocket on the right side that wasn't being cleared. If you're experiencing a similar problem with this things, that's probably the problem.
